Only a person with a great understanding can make complex things explain as simple as possible! Nice video Prof.! One question, you've mentioned R, L components, why left out C, because in this case it can be neglected? every wire has the L, R, C components
@sambenyaakov
@sambenyaakov 3 роки тому
Thanks for comment. The C component does not affect the basic operation (small enough) but can cause ringing problems and losses. Good point.

How do I pick carrier frequency for the PWM signal used to control acceleration/brake regen? I have been building a custom driver and so far the motor spins the best at around 500hz, but not significantly better than at 350, 1200 and 16000 khz (PWM carrier frequencies). At 350hz carrier frequency the rotor speed, stator heat and unloaded power draw is the worst (probably too much short circuit load during the current recirculation period, as I think it goes in the equivalent of dis-continuous conduction mode). Changing the PWM signal duty cycle successfully alters the rotor speed and under about 30% PWM signal duty cycle the idle power consumption sharply drops. Advancing the hall sensor timing angle slightly helps with rotor speed and torque is reduced (as expected), but does nothing to help unloaded power draw.
